Aqueous solution of Cu (II) gives an intense blue solution with ammonia,which is due to
Options
(a) [Cu(NH₃)₄]²⁺
(b) Cu(OH)₂
(c) [Cu(H₂O₆)]²⁺
(d) Cu(NH₃)₂
Correct Answer:
[Cu(NH₃)₄]²⁺
